I did 10 LGs today (Simple and Complex Ordering and one In/Out Grouping). Timing felt good and accuracy was also solid. One thing that I've noticed is the value of eliminating answers that are clearly wrong. Yes, there are certainly problems that you can identify the right answer and be off to the races, but a lot of questions are expedited by knocking off the answers that are clearly wrong first. I'm glad I'm starting to recognize that.

I just redid the LG on PT 33. I've seen these games before, so I finished Games 1 and 4 in just over 6 minutes. I finished Game 2 in under 8. But the third game (about a jeweler with rubies, sapphires, and topazes) destroyed me again. I got all of them right, but it took me 14.5 minutes to do. I think trying to split the game board was a bad idea. There were just too many possibilities. It didn't really help. I think these grouping games where the numerical distribution is not fixed may be my least favorite type of LG. Sometimes it helps to split. Other times it doesn't, but I guess that's true for other games as well.
